The song ‘SPINNIN' ON IT’ by the group NMIXX has made it onto the list of ‘Best Songs of the Year’ as selected by the prominent British music magazine NME.

On the 1st (local time), the British music magazine NME announced on its official website that NMIXX's track ‘SPINNIN' ON IT’ from their first full album ranked 43rd in the ‘50 Best Songs of 2025’.

NME praised ‘SPINNIN' ON IT’, stating, “It unfolds a precarious romance with a sweet and bittersweet lyrical pop-rock sensibility,” adding, “The delicately layered percussion and bass line enhance the passionate atmosphere, and as the song progresses, the six members calmly reveal that this chaotic love will ultimately continue.”

NMIXX proved their musical growth with their latest work, the first full album ‘Blue Valentine’, released last October (KST). The title track ‘Blue Valentine’ maintained the top spot on major Korean music site Melon’s Top 100, daily and weekly charts, and reached the top of the monthly chart in November 2025, marking another career high.

Thanks to the popularity of ‘Blue Valentine’, NMIXX kicked off their debut world tour ‘EPISODE 1: ZERO FRONTIER’ on November 29-30 (KST) at the Inspire Arena in Incheon. In this performance, which is both their first solo concert and the starting point of the world tour, NMIXX drew enthusiastic responses from the audience with their solid live performance and choreography befitting a ‘hexagonal girl group’.

The cities for NMIXX's first world tour will be announced sequentially later, and they are expected to meet fans in Korea and other countries with a rich setlist including ‘SPINNIN' ON IT’ and ‘Blue Valentine’.
